Grilled Caprese Sandwich with Balsamic Glaze
Sourdough bread toasted until golden, layered with juicy tomatoes, creamy mozzarella, and grilled chicken drizzled with a tangy balsamic glaze.
INGREDIENTS
4 oz chicken breast
2 slices whole grain sourdough bread
1.5 oz fresh mozzarella cheese
2 slices tomato
4 leaves fresh basil
1 tbsp balsamic glaze
1 tsp extra virgin olive oil
0.25 tsp sea salt
0.25 tsp black pepper
0.5 tsp dried oregano
PREPARATION
Season the chicken breast with sea salt, black pepper, and dried oregano on both sides.
Heat a grill pan over medium-high heat and cook the chicken for 5 to 6 minutes per side until the internal temperature reaches 165°F.
Remove the chicken from the heat and slice it into thin strips.
Lightly brush the outside of the sourdough bread slices with the extra virgin olive oil.
On the non-oiled side of one slice, layer the sliced chicken, fresh mozzarella, and tomato slices.
Place the second slice of bread on top with the oiled side facing outward.
Heat a clean skillet over medium heat and grill the sandwich for 3 to 4 minutes per side until the bread is golden brown and the cheese is melted.
Carefully open the sandwich to tuck in the fresh basil leaves and drizzle with balsamic glaze before serving warm before serving.
